CHAPTER 1
CIVIL AVIATION AUTHORITY OF PAKISTAN
1.1 overview:
Pakistan Civil Aviation Authority (CAA) is a public sector autonomous body working under the
Federal Government of Pakistan through Aviation Division Cabinet Secretariat. CAA was
established on 7th December, 1982 through Pakistan Civil Aviation Authority ordinance 1982 to
handle all matters related to civil aviation in Pakistan. In order to keep up rapid advancement in
the field of aviation, it was felt that an autonomous body was required to bring the country’s
aviation infrastructure and facilities as par with international standard.
1.2 Purpose:
The CAA not only serves as a regulatory body on behalf of the government of Pakistan, its
functions include provision of services such as facilitation, air space management, air traffic
control, firefighting services, planning, maintenance development of all civil aviation
infrastructures in the country. CAA ensures conformity to the standard laid down by the
international civil aviation organization (ICAO), regard to flight safety and air traffic control and
navigation system. It secure the life which travel in air and CAA also self decision

3.1 RADAR:
Radio Detection And Ranging was developed secretly for military use by several nations in the
period before and during World War II. Radar is an object-detection system that uses radio
waves to determine the range, angle, or velocity of objects. It can be used to
detect aircraft, ships, spacecraft, guided missiles, motor vehicles, weather formations,
and terrain. A radar system consists of a transmitter producing electromagnetic waves in the
radio or microwaves domain, a transmitting antenna, a receiving antenna (often the same
antenna is used for transmitting and receiving) and a receiver and processor to determine
properties of the object(s). Radio waves (pulsed or continuous) from the transmitter reflect off the
object and return to the receiver, giving information about the object's location and speed.
Figure: Civil-Aviation Radar
One of the fields in which radar technique has made very large contributions is that of air navigation
In war-time, aircraft must fly in all kinds of weather, by day and by night, and the development of
radio aids to replace those visual aids available in clear weather was of paramount importance. Life
of Radar maximum is 9 year

3.2.1 Primary Radar
A Primary radar is also called Primary Surveillance Radar is a conventional radar sensor that
illuminates a large portion of space with an electromagnetic wave and receives back the reflected
waves from targets within that space. The term thus refers to a radar system used to detect and
localize potentially non-cooperative targets. It is specific to the field of air traffic control where it is
opposed to the secondary radar which receives additional information from the
target's transponder.
This type of radar uses low vertical resolution antenna but good horizontal resolution. It quickly scans 360
degrees around the site on a single elevation angle.The advantages of the primary radar are no on-board
equipment in the aircraft is necessary for detecting the target and can be used to monitor the movement of
vehicles on the ground. The disadvantages are that the target and altitude can not be identified directly. In
addition, it requires powerful emissions which limits its scope.

3.2.2 Secondary Radar
Secondary surveillance radar is a radar system used in air traffic control (ATC), that not only detects and
measures the position of aircraft i.e. bearing, but also requests additional information from the aircraft
itself such as its identity and altitude. Unlike primary radar systems that measure the bearing of targets
using the detected reflections of radio signals. SSR is based on the military identification friend or
foe (IFF) technology originally developed during World War II, therefore the two systems are still
compatible
Only Secondary radar are allocate in some cities of Pakistan such as Lakpass, Pasni, and
Rojhan. Also both primary and secondary radar are allocated at Karachi, Lahore and Islamabad.

4.2 Instrument Landing System:
Instrument Landing System (ILS) is defined as a precision runway approach aid based on two
radio beams which together provide pilots with both vertical and horizontal guidance during an
approach to land.it two radio beams to provide pilots with vertical and horizontal guidance during
the landing approach. The localizer (LOC) provides azimuth guidance, while the glideslope (GS)
defines the correct vertical descent profile. Marker beacons and high intensity runways lights may
also be provided as aids to the use of an ILS, although the former are more likely nowadays to
have been replaced by a DME integral to the ILS or one otherwise located on the aerodrome, for
example with a VOR.

4.4 Glide Slope
• It is use for up and down takeoff
• It is same as localizer but minor different
• It frequency range 328-336mhz
• On threshold point use of glide slope
• Its width is 1,4 adjust by airline
The glide slope (or glide path) is an imaginary line that travels from the approach end of the
runway upwards to the aircraft that is about to land When an aircraft is above the glide slope,
the touchdown speed will be higher and there is a chance that it may land too far down the
runway, forcing a go-around. This is because a higher altitude is exchanged for more speed as
the aircraft descends at a higher rate of descent. When an aircraft is below the glide slope, there
is a chance that he may land short of the runway and is more prone to stalls. This is because
the rate of descent has to be reduce and an inexperienced pilot may instinctively pull up,
causing a loss of speed.

5.2.1 walkie talkie
walkie talkie is is a hand-held, portable two-way radio transceiver. Its development during
the Second World War A walkie-talkie is a half-duplex communication device; multiple walkie-
talkies use a single radio channel, and only one radio on the channel can transmit at a time,
although any number can listen The transceiver is normally in receive mode; when the user
wants to talk he presses a "push-to-talk" (PTT) button that turns off the receiver and turns on the
transmitter.
Here is figure of walkie talkie, in vhf section there are two type of walkie talkie one walkie talkie is
set on the AM frequency channel and second walkie talkie is set on the FM channel. The AM
frequency is used for the ground to air which was portable and the FM frequency is use for the
ground to ground and it was fixed and the FM walkie talkie is used on airport for ground
communication and also its range is 2km and our airport is range is 4km then for high range
requirement we use “repeater” the purpose of repeater to amplify the signal. And repeater is use
in both AM and FM walkie talkie module.

6.3 PA SYSTEM
Pa system is also known as public address system. It is an electronic sound amplification and
distribution system with a microphone, amplifier and loudspeakers, used to allow a person to
speak to a large public for example for announcements of movements at large and noisy air and
rail terminals or at a sports stadium or amplify other audio content, such as recorded music or the
live sound of a band. he term is also used for systems which may additionally have a mixing
console, and amplifiers and loudspeakers suitable for music as well as speech, used to reinforce
a sound source, such as recorded music or a person giving a speech or distributing the sound
throughout a venue, building or area. Simple PA systems are often used in small venues such as
school auditoriums, churches, and small bars. PA systems with many speakers are widely used
to make announcements in public, institutional and commercial buildings and locations, such
as schools, stadiums and large passenger vessels and aircraft. Intercom systems, installed in
many buildings, have both speakers throughout a building, and microphones in many rooms
allowing the occupants to respond to announcements.

7.2 Equipment tested during workshop:
7.2.1 Fax machine
Fax (short for facsimile), sometimes called telecopying or telefax.it is the telephonic
transmission of scanned printed material (both text and images), normally to a telephone
number connected to a printer or other output device The original document is scanned with
a fax machine (or a telecopier), which processes the contents (text or images) as a single fixed
19. 19
graphic image, converting it into a bitmap, and then transmitting it through the telephone system
in the form of audio-frequency tones

7.3 Fire Alarm System
It has a number of devices working together to detect and warn people through visual and audio
appliances when smoke, fire, carbon monoxide or other emergencies are present. These alarms
may be activated automatically from smoke detectors, and heat detectors or may also be
activated via manual fire alarm activation devices such as manual call points or pull stations.
Alarms can be either motorized bells or wall mountable sounders or horns. They can also be
speaker strobes which sound an alarm, followed by a voice evacuation message which warns
people inside the building not to use the elevators

9.2 AVR
AVR stand for automatic voltage regulator. It is also a stabilizer, the purpose of use to maintain
the voltage, if voltage is high or low then it automatically set desire voltage. This is an active
system. While the basic principle is the same, the system itself is more complex. An automatic
voltage regulator (or AVR for short) consists of several components such as diodes, capacitors,
resistors and potentiometers or even microcontrollers, all placed on a circuit board. n the first
place the AVR monitors the output voltage and controls the input voltage for the exciter of the
generator. By increasing or decreasing the generator control voltage, the output voltage of the
generator increases or decreases accordingly. The AVR calculates how much voltage has to be
sent to the exciter numerous times a second, therefore stabilizing the output voltage to a
predetermined setpoint. When two or more generators are powering the same system (parallel
operation) the AVR receives information from more generators to match all output.
